AUTHOR=Haqqu Rizca , Zahrani Alya Rahma , Wulandari Astri , Ersyad Firdaus Azwar , Adim Adrio Kusmareza TITLE=Human-AI in affordance perspective: a study on ChatGPT users in the context of Indonesian users JOURNAL=Frontiers in Computer Science VOLUME=Volume 7 - 2025 YEAR=2025 URL=https://www.frontiersin.org/journals/computer-science/articles/10.3389/fcomp.2025.1623029 DOI=10.3389/fcomp.2025.1623029 ISSN=2624-9898 ABSTRACT=This study explores the interaction between humans and artificial intelligence (AI) through the lens of affordance theory, focusing on how Indonesian users experience and interpret ChatGPT in their daily lives. Adopting a socioconstructivist approach to affordance, the research investigates how users perceive, adapt to, and assign meaning to ChatGPT’s capabilities beyond its technical design. Using a qualitative descriptive method with light netnographic observation, this study examines user interactions and discussions within online communities. The findings reveal that affordances are not solely embedded in the AI system but emerge relationally, shaped by users’ intentions, contexts, and social interpretations. ChatGPT is variously perceived as a thinking assistant, productivity enhancer, confidence booster, and reflective partner. These perceptions are informed by diverse user motivations, such as improving work efficiency, overcoming cognitive barriers, or seeking emotional support in moments of solitude. The study identifies a dynamic interaction between technological features and human agency, highlighting how users’ lived experiences co-construct the functional and symbolic value of AI. This research contributes to the evolving discourse on human–AI relationships by emphasizing the subjective and socially situated nature of affordances, offering insights into how users domesticate AI tools in everyday contexts. Ultimately, the study challenges deterministic views of technology by demonstrating that the perceived value of AI is co-created through experiential engagement rather than solely defined by its technical affordances.
